    Question Mach 3 Cycle Start Button Configuration

    Morning everyone,
    I a m running a CNC Router Parts CNC Benchtop Pro router with Mach 3. I am trying to configure a push button for the cycle start command. I already tried to do the following and no success:
    1. Assign the port and pin to OEM code 1.
    2. Assign OEM Code to 1000 to Trigger 1
    3. Attach switch to appropriate pin on you breakout board"pin 12 in my case" Port 1
    4......Nothing

    Please help. Does anyone else have the Benchtop Pro router hooked up with a cycle start button?
